What is an Associate Laser RN?

Associate Laser RNs are registered nurses who specialize in performing or assisting with laser-based procedures, often in dermatology, aesthetics, or surgical settings. They are responsible for patient assessment, preparing and operating laser equipment, and ensuring safety protocols are followed during treatments. These nurses typically work under the supervision of physicians or advanced practice providers and may also provide patient education regarding pre- and post-procedure care. Certification or specialized training in laser technology is often required, alongside a valid RN license.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Associate Laser RN?

To thrive as an Associate Laser RN, you need a nursing degree with current RN licensure, a solid understanding of laser safety, and experience in dermatological or cosmetic procedures. Familiarity with laser devices, documentation software, and certifications like Laser Safety Officer (LSO) are highly valued. Excellent patient communication, attention to detail, and the ability to reassure clients are crucial soft skills in this role. These competencies ensure safe, effective treatments while fostering patient trust and satisfaction in a regulated clinical environment.

What is the difference between Associate Laser Rn vs Laser Technician?

AspectAssociate Laser RnLaser Technician
CertificationsRegistered Nurse (RN) license, laser certificationLaser safety and technician certifications
Work EnvironmentMedical clinics, hospitals, dermatology officesMedical spas, cosmetic clinics, salons
Job ResponsibilitiesPatient assessment, administering laser treatments, monitoring patient healthOperating laser equipment, preparing patients, maintaining safety protocols

The Associate Laser Rn and Laser Technician roles share some certifications and work environments, but the RN role involves patient care and medical oversight, while the Laser Technician focuses on operating equipment and assisting with treatments. Both roles are essential in cosmetic and medical laser settings, with the RN typically requiring a nursing license and broader clinical responsibilities.
